Cost-Effective CRM Solutions For Startups And Small Enterprises
Cost-effective CRM solutions for startups and small enterprises are crucial for growth. Finding the right balance between functionality and affordability is key to success, especially for businesses with limited budgets. This exploration examines various CRM options, considering factors like pricing models, essential features, and long-term scalability to help businesses make informed decisions that align with their specific needs and growth trajectory.
We’ll delve into the critical aspects of choosing a CRM, from defining your business’s specific requirements at different growth stages to understanding the hidden costs associated with implementation and ongoing maintenance. We’ll also explore methods for measuring the return on investment (ROI) and strategies for optimizing your chosen CRM for maximum effectiveness.
Defining Needs for Startups and Small Enterprises
Choosing the right CRM is crucial for startups and small enterprises. The ideal system will streamline operations, improve customer relationships, and ultimately drive growth. However, the specific needs vary greatly depending on the company’s size, stage of development, and overall business goals. Selecting a CRM that aligns with these factors is essential for maximizing its effectiveness and return on investment.
Startups and small businesses have distinct CRM requirements compared to larger corporations. Their needs often center around simplicity, affordability, and ease of use. Complex features found in enterprise-level CRMs are generally unnecessary and can even be counterproductive, leading to confusion and wasted resources. Instead, focus should be on core functionalities that directly support sales, marketing, and customer service efforts.
Essential CRM Features for Startups and Small Businesses
Startups and small businesses typically require a CRM that handles contact management, lead tracking, basic sales pipeline management, and communication tools. Features like reporting and analytics are also valuable, even in their simplest forms, to provide a basic understanding of sales performance and customer engagement. Integration with other business tools, such as email marketing platforms and accounting software, is also highly beneficial for streamlining workflows. Advanced features such as automation, extensive reporting, and complex segmentation are usually less critical in the early stages.
CRM Needs Across Startup Stages
The CRM needs of a startup evolve significantly as it progresses through different funding stages. Seed-stage startups might only need a basic contact management system to track leads and customers. As they move into Series A and beyond, more sophisticated features, such as sales pipeline management and marketing automation, become increasingly important to manage a growing customer base and sales team. Series B and beyond may require more advanced reporting and analytics to track key performance indicators (KPIs) and inform strategic decision-making. For example, a seed-stage company might use a simple free CRM like HubSpot’s free plan to manage contacts, while a Series A company might upgrade to a paid plan with more robust sales pipeline and reporting features, or even consider a more comprehensive paid CRM like Zoho CRM or Salesforce Sales Cloud.
Scalability in CRM Selection
Scalability is a critical factor when choosing a CRM, especially for growing businesses. The chosen system should be able to adapt to increasing data volume, user numbers, and evolving business needs without significant disruption or costly upgrades. Cloud-based CRMs generally offer better scalability than on-premise solutions, as they can easily accommodate growth by simply increasing user licenses or storage capacity. This flexibility is crucial for startups anticipating rapid expansion, ensuring they can avoid the need to switch CRMs as they scale. For example, a company experiencing rapid growth might initially use a cloud-based CRM with a pay-as-you-go pricing model, allowing them to easily adjust their subscription based on their evolving needs.
Comparison of Free vs. Paid CRM Options
Feature | Free CRM | Paid CRM | Notes |
---|---|---|---|
Contact Management | Limited number of contacts, basic features | Unlimited contacts, advanced features (segmentation, tagging) | Free options often restrict the number of users and contacts. |
Lead Management | Basic lead tracking, limited automation | Advanced lead scoring, automation workflows, lead routing | Paid CRMs offer features to nurture leads and improve conversion rates. |
Sales Pipeline Management | Simple pipeline visualization, limited reporting | Detailed pipeline visualization, customizable stages, advanced reporting | Paid CRMs provide better insights into sales performance. |
Reporting and Analytics | Basic reports, limited customization | Customizable dashboards, advanced reporting, predictive analytics | Free CRMs typically offer only basic reporting capabilities. |
Customer Support | Limited or community-based support | Dedicated customer support, priority assistance | Paid CRMs usually offer faster and more reliable support. |
Integrations | Limited integrations | Extensive integrations with other business tools | Paid CRMs often provide more robust integration capabilities. |
Exploring Cost-Effective CRM Solutions
Choosing the right CRM is crucial for startups and small enterprises, impacting efficiency and growth. A cost-effective solution balances functionality with budget constraints, allowing businesses to manage customer relationships without significant financial burden. This section explores affordable CRM options, their pricing models, and associated costs.
Affordable CRM Platforms for Startups and Small Businesses
Several CRM platforms offer tailored solutions for businesses with limited budgets. These platforms typically provide core CRM functionalities such as contact management, lead tracking, and basic reporting, often scaling their features and pricing based on user needs. Examples include HubSpot CRM, Zoho CRM, and Bitrix24. Each platform offers a different blend of features and pricing strategies, enabling businesses to select the option best suited to their specific requirements.
CRM Pricing Models: Subscription, Freemium, and One-Time Purchase
Understanding the various pricing models is essential for selecting a financially viable CRM. Subscription models offer flexible, recurring payments, often tiered based on features and user numbers. Freemium models provide a basic, free version with limited functionalities, allowing businesses to upgrade to paid plans for advanced features. One-time purchase models, less common in the CRM market, involve a single upfront payment for the software license, potentially requiring additional costs for updates and support. The choice depends on the business’s budget, anticipated growth, and required features.
Comparison of Three CRM Solutions
The following table compares three popular and affordable CRM solutions: HubSpot CRM, Zoho CRM, and Bitrix24. This comparison highlights their pricing models, key features, and target audience. Note that pricing can vary based on specific plans and add-ons.
CRM Name | Pricing Model | Key Features | Target Audience |
---|---|---|---|
HubSpot CRM | Freemium (with paid options) | Contact management, deal tracking, email marketing integration, basic reporting, sales pipeline management. | Startups and small businesses with limited budgets, focusing on sales and marketing automation. |
Zoho CRM | Subscription (various tiers) | Contact management, lead management, sales pipeline management, custom reporting, mobile access, integration with other Zoho apps. | Small to medium-sized businesses seeking a comprehensive CRM with scalable features. |
Bitrix24 | Freemium (with paid options) | Contact management, project management, task management, communication tools (chat, video conferencing), CRM functionality, website builder. | Startups and small businesses needing a combined CRM and project management solution. |
Hidden Costs of CRM Implementation
While initial pricing is crucial, businesses must also consider hidden costs associated with CRM implementation. These costs often include training for staff to effectively utilize the chosen platform, integration with existing business systems (such as accounting software or e-commerce platforms), and potential ongoing maintenance and support fees. Failure to account for these hidden costs can significantly impact the overall budget. For example, integrating a CRM with an existing accounting system might require custom development or the services of a third-party integrator, adding unforeseen expenses. Thorough planning and budgeting for these additional costs is vital for successful CRM implementation.
Evaluating CRM Features and Functionality
Choosing the right CRM involves carefully assessing its features and how well they align with your business needs. A poorly chosen system can hinder productivity rather than enhance it. Therefore, a thorough evaluation is crucial before committing to a particular solution.
Contact Management
Effective contact management is the cornerstone of any successful CRM. This goes beyond simply storing contact details. A robust CRM should allow for detailed profiles including interaction history, purchase history, communication preferences, and custom fields relevant to your business. This allows for personalized interactions and targeted marketing efforts, leading to increased customer engagement and loyalty. For instance, a bakery could track customer preferences for specific pastries and send targeted birthday offers or seasonal promotions based on this data. The ability to segment contacts based on various criteria (e.g., purchase frequency, location) is also vital for efficient marketing campaigns.
Sales Pipeline Management
Managing the sales pipeline efficiently is essential for tracking leads, monitoring progress, and forecasting revenue. A good CRM provides tools to visualize the sales process, track deals at each stage (from lead generation to closing), and identify potential bottlenecks. This visual representation allows for better resource allocation and proactive intervention to accelerate the sales cycle. For example, a software company could use a visual pipeline to identify leads that are stuck in a particular stage and take targeted action, such as sending follow-up emails or scheduling a call. This visibility improves sales team performance and increases overall sales efficiency.
Customer Support Features
Excellent customer support is key to customer retention. A CRM system should facilitate efficient handling of customer inquiries and complaints. Features such as ticketing systems, knowledge bases, and integrated communication channels (email, phone, chat) are vital for providing prompt and effective support. This centralized system improves response times, reduces resolution times, and enhances customer satisfaction. A clothing retailer, for example, could use the CRM to track customer service interactions, ensuring consistency and identifying areas for improvement in their support processes.
Cloud-Based vs. On-Premise CRM Systems
The choice between cloud-based and on-premise CRM systems depends on various factors including budget, technical expertise, and security requirements.
Cloud-Based CRM Advantages and Disadvantages
Cloud-based CRMs offer accessibility from anywhere with an internet connection, automatic updates, scalability, and typically lower upfront costs. However, they rely on a stable internet connection and may have security concerns depending on the provider’s security measures. Data breaches are a possibility although reputable providers invest heavily in security protocols.
On-Premise CRM Advantages and Disadvantages
On-premise systems offer greater control over data and security, but require significant upfront investment in hardware and software, ongoing maintenance, and IT expertise. They lack the accessibility and scalability of cloud-based systems.
Lead Generation and Nurturing Workflow
A small business could use a CRM to streamline lead generation and nurturing through a multi-stage process.
- Lead Capture: Collect leads through website forms, social media campaigns, or trade shows. The CRM automatically records these leads with relevant details.
- Lead Qualification: Use the CRM to segment leads based on criteria such as industry, company size, or budget. This helps prioritize high-potential leads.
- Lead Nurturing: Automate email marketing campaigns to engage leads with relevant content at each stage of the sales funnel. The CRM tracks email opens, clicks, and other engagement metrics.
- Sales Follow-up: Sales representatives use the CRM to track interactions with leads and manage the sales pipeline. The CRM provides a centralized view of all communications and activities.
- Conversion and Retention: Once a lead converts into a customer, the CRM tracks their purchases, interactions, and feedback, facilitating ongoing customer relationship management and retention efforts.
Essential CRM Integrations
Integrating the CRM with other business tools enhances its functionality and efficiency.
Several key integrations are beneficial for startups:
- Email Marketing Platforms (e.g., Mailchimp, Constant Contact): Automate email marketing campaigns and track engagement metrics.
- Social Media Management Tools (e.g., Hootsuite, Buffer): Manage social media interactions and track lead generation from social media channels.
- E-commerce Platforms (e.g., Shopify, WooCommerce): Integrate customer data from online sales to provide a complete view of customer interactions.
- Accounting Software (e.g., Xero, QuickBooks): Track sales revenue and expenses, providing financial insights.
Implementation and Support Considerations
Successfully implementing a cost-effective CRM requires careful planning and execution. A smooth transition minimizes disruption to daily operations and maximizes the return on investment. This involves a phased approach, encompassing data migration, user training, and ongoing support.
Implementing a new CRM system within a small business involves several key steps. First, a thorough needs assessment must be conducted to ensure the chosen CRM aligns with the business’s specific requirements. This is followed by selecting and configuring the system, migrating existing data, and training employees on its use. Finally, ongoing monitoring and support are crucial for maintaining system effectiveness and addressing any arising issues.
CRM Implementation Steps for Small Businesses
A successful CRM implementation follows a structured approach. The process typically begins with defining project goals and timelines. This is followed by data cleansing and migration, ensuring data accuracy and integrity. Next, the CRM system is configured to meet the specific needs of the business, and user training is provided. Finally, the system is launched, and ongoing support and maintenance are implemented to ensure its long-term effectiveness. Regular monitoring and adjustments are crucial to optimize the CRM’s performance and adapt to changing business needs.
Successful CRM Implementation Strategies for Startups
Startups often benefit from a phased rollout of their CRM system. For example, a startup might begin by implementing the CRM within its sales team, gradually expanding to other departments as the team becomes proficient and the system’s benefits become apparent. This approach minimizes disruption and allows for iterative improvements based on early user feedback. Another strategy is to leverage the CRM’s reporting and analytics capabilities to track key metrics and demonstrate the system’s value to stakeholders. This approach can help secure ongoing support and investment in the CRM system. A final successful strategy is to choose a CRM solution that integrates easily with other business tools, such as email marketing platforms and accounting software. This integration streamlines workflows and improves data consistency.
Importance of Ongoing Training and Support for Users
Ongoing training and support are essential for maximizing the return on investment in a CRM system. Regular training sessions help users stay up-to-date on new features and best practices. Providing readily accessible support resources, such as FAQs, online tutorials, and dedicated support staff, ensures users can quickly resolve issues and get the most out of the system. Without sufficient training and support, user adoption rates can be low, hindering the system’s overall effectiveness. This leads to underutilization and a poor return on investment. Regular feedback mechanisms allow for continuous improvement of the system and its user experience.
Best Practices for Data Migration and Ensuring Data Security
Data migration is a critical step in CRM implementation. Best practices include thoroughly cleaning and validating data before migration, using a secure data transfer method, and regularly backing up data. To ensure data security, businesses should implement strong password policies, access controls, and data encryption. Regular security audits and compliance with relevant data privacy regulations are also crucial. For example, a company migrating data from a legacy system might employ a phased approach, migrating data in batches to minimize disruption and allow for error correction. They would also implement robust security protocols to protect sensitive customer information during the migration process. This includes encrypting data both in transit and at rest, as well as implementing multi-factor authentication to prevent unauthorized access.
Measuring ROI and Success
Implementing a CRM system is an investment, and like any investment, understanding its return is crucial. Successfully measuring the ROI of your CRM requires a strategic approach focusing on relevant Key Performance Indicators (KPIs) and a clear understanding of how different CRM features contribute to overall business goals. This section details methods for tracking progress and identifying areas for optimization.
Tracking Key Performance Indicators (KPIs)
Effective CRM usage is demonstrable through a variety of quantifiable metrics. Regularly monitoring these KPIs provides valuable insights into the system’s impact on your business. By tracking these metrics, you can identify successes, areas needing improvement, and ultimately demonstrate the value of your CRM investment.
CRM Features and Improved Business Outcomes
The following table illustrates how specific CRM features contribute to measurable improvements in key business areas. The expected outcomes are generalized; specific results will vary depending on individual business contexts and implementation strategies.
CRM Feature | KPI | Measurement Method | Expected Outcome |
---|---|---|---|
Lead Management | Lead Conversion Rate | (Number of Closed-Won Deals / Number of Qualified Leads) x 100 | Increased conversion rate, leading to higher sales |
Sales Pipeline Management | Average Deal Size | Total Revenue / Number of Closed-Won Deals | Larger average deal value, improving revenue per sale |
Customer Support Ticketing System | Customer Satisfaction (CSAT) Score | Surveys measuring customer satisfaction post-interaction | Improved customer satisfaction, leading to increased loyalty and positive word-of-mouth |
Marketing Automation | Marketing Qualified Leads (MQLs) | Number of leads generated through marketing campaigns that meet pre-defined criteria | Increased number of qualified leads entering the sales funnel |
Reporting and Analytics | Sales Cycle Length | Time from initial contact to deal closure | Shorter sales cycles, leading to faster revenue generation |
Calculating Return on Investment (ROI)
Calculating the ROI of your CRM involves comparing the total cost of implementation and maintenance against the gains realized. A simplified formula is:
ROI = (Net Profit from CRM Implementation – Cost of CRM Implementation) / Cost of CRM Implementation x 100%
For example, if a CRM implementation cost $5,000 and generated an additional $15,000 in revenue within a year (after accounting for all associated costs), the ROI would be:
ROI = ($15,000 – $5,000) / $5,000 x 100% = 200%
This calculation highlights the significant return on investment achieved. Remember to factor in all costs, including software licenses, implementation services, training, and ongoing maintenance.
Identifying Areas for Improvement and Optimization
Regularly reviewing your CRM’s performance data is crucial for identifying areas for improvement. Analyze trends in your KPIs. For example, if lead conversion rates are consistently low, investigate the stages of your sales pipeline. Are leads being properly qualified? Is your sales team utilizing the CRM effectively? Similarly, low CSAT scores might indicate issues with customer support processes. Use the insights gathered to refine your CRM strategy, optimize workflows, and maximize the system’s potential.
Closure
Ultimately, selecting the right cost-effective CRM is a strategic decision that can significantly impact a startup or small enterprise’s success. By carefully considering your needs, exploring available options, and implementing a robust strategy for utilization and optimization, businesses can leverage the power of CRM to streamline operations, enhance customer relationships, and drive sustainable growth. Remember that ongoing evaluation and adaptation are essential to ensure your chosen solution continues to meet your evolving business requirements.